Explore the majestic old-growth redwood trees at Jedediah Smith Redwoods State Park. Take a leisurely stroll along the Stout Grove trail to immerse yourself in nature's beauty.
Drive south on US-101 for about 10 miles to reach the park.
Head to Prairie Creek Redwoods State Park for more redwood forest exploration. Hike the James Irvine Trail to see massive trees and the famous Fern Canyon.
Drive south on US-101 for about 40 minutes to reach the park entrance.

Explore the stunning Gold Bluffs Beach in Prairie Creek Redwoods State Park. Take a leisurely walk along the sandy shores and admire the rugged coastline.
Drive to Prairie Creek Redwoods State Park, following signs to Gold Bluffs Beach.
Pack a picnic lunch and enjoy it amidst the ethereal beauty of Fern Canyon. Marvel at the lush greenery and fern-covered walls that have been featured in movies like Jurassic Park.
Hike or drive to Fern Canyon from Gold Bluffs Beach.
Embark on a scenic hike along the Coastal Trail in Prairie Creek Redwoods State Park. Enjoy panoramic views of the Pacific Ocean and the chance to spot wildlife like elk.
Access the Coastal Trail from the Fern Canyon parking area.
